Chromakey Backdrops: Mastering Green Screen Photography
Achieving remarkable chroma key imaging can seem challenging at first, but with the appropriate grasp of chromakey backdrops, it’s easily accessible. These material backdrops, typically green, act as a blank canvas that can be effortlessly eliminated in post-production, allowing you to insert amazing effects. Proper lighting is essential; preventing shadows and guaranteeing even illumination across the surface will significantly improve the outcome. Ultimately, gaining green screen methods opens up limitless options for videographers of all levels.
Picking the Right Backdrop: Theatre?
Deciding for the suitable backdrop is a significant choice, based on the type of setting. In a image studio, think about simple, clean backdrops like seamless paper or fabric drops. Gatherings, however, typically benefit from lively options, such as custom banners, garden walls, or even decorated fabrics. Finally, theatre productions need backdrops representing robust and capable of complex scene changes, often involving painted canvases or substantial printed materials. To sum up, this decision has to show the overall feel of the event.
